Where Can Outback Gift Cards Be Used?

You can purchase the gift card on the Outback Steakhouse official website and use it in their restaurants and to order meals online. Since Outback Steakhouse is one of the Bloomin’ Brands restaurants, you can use the gift card in their other chains, including:

  • Bonefish Grill
  • Carraba’s Italian Grill
  • Fleming's Prime Steakhouse & Wine Bar

An Outback gift card is pre-loaded with a specific amount of money (typically between $10 and $500) and comes in two forms:

  • Plastic
  • Digital (eCard)

Both cards are equally valid, with the digital card being more practical for online purchases.

How To Perform an Outback Gift Card Balance Check

You can check the balance on your Outback gift card in one of the three ways presented in the table below:

Method Steps
In person
  1. Visit one of the local Outback restaurants
  2. Provide necessary details about the card to the cashier
  3. Get the information on the remaining balance right then and there
Online
  1. Access the Outback Steakhouse website
  2. Find the Check Balance button at the bottom of the page and click
  3. Enter the card number and the security code
  4. Hit Submit
By phone
  1. Call Outback Steakhouse at (888) 731-2610
  2. Give the employee details of your gift card
  3. Find out your balance instantly

I Have Performed an Outback Steakhouse Gift Card Balance Check—What Can I Do With the Remaining Money?

Is there some remaining balance on your Outback gift card? You may be wondering what to do with it if:

  1. You don’t want to use the card anymore
  2. The remaining amount is too small to make a purchase

Depending on the situation, you can choose between the following options:

  • Use the gift card in other restaurants—If you have enough money to buy yourself a dinner but are sick of eating from the same restaurant, you can use the Outback gift card in other Bloomin’ Brands restaurants in the U.S.
  • Recharge the card—If you want to continue using the card, you can recharge it. Make sure to check the balance regularly. If there is no more money on it, the card will no longer be valid, and you will have to buy another one
  • Combine multiple gift cards—If you have more Outback Steakhouse gift cards with small amounts of cash on them, you can combine them to make a purchase

Can You Ask for Gift Card Cash Back From Outback Steakhouse?

What if you have a couple of dollars on your Outback Steakhouse gift card that you don’t want to or can't spend? Most people let that money go to waste, not knowing that they can get it in cash easily!

While Outback Steakhouse claims the gift cards are not redeemable for cash unless required by law, that doesn’t mean the case is closed. Your first move is to check if you live in one of the U.S. states (including Puerto Rico) that require companies to provide gift card cash reimbursements to their customers. Bear in mind that the balance on the gift card usually cannot be higher than $5, while in California, the limit is up to $10.
